Energy reseach center planned for Fairbanks, Alaska, campus

Jan. 28, 2009
University of Alaska Fairbanks wants to build $30 million facility

TheUniversity of Alaska Fairbanks has tentative plans to build a 31,000-square-foot building dedicated to energy research — everything from wind and hydrogen to coal.
